Imke Courtois
Imke Courtois (born 14 March 1988) is a Belgian footballer who plays as a midfielder for Standard Fémina de Liège and the Belgium women's national football team.

Personal life
Imke is often asked if she is Thibaut Courtois' sister. As a joke she started a company called 'Niet de zus van' (English: [not sister] Error: {{Lang}}: text has italic markup (help)) and said: "for once and for all: no, Thibaut is not my brother."[1]
